Beginners Guide to Metal Polishing - Mostly, metal polishing is important for aesthetics as well as clean-room uses. It is among the most preferred solutions simply because of its utility in intensifying the natural attractiveness of the item, as an example, motorbike parts, cookware or vehicle parts. Besides that, lots of clean-rooms call for a lustrous finish in an effort to limit the porosity of the components which can result in particles to collect and contaminate. A really good instance of this use would be in a vacuum chamber.

There are quite a few approaches to polish metals, and we are going to examine the various techniques involved. Metal can be burnished by means of chemicals, electromechanically, using purpose built buffing machines, or simply manually. A finishing compound or paste is often put into use, which may incorporate ch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Finish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, fairly high viscidness, and hardness is just about the time-consuming. Having said that, goods fabricated from non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to polishing, since these need the least number of treatments.

Finishing buffs smothered in compound will be appreciably affected by specific force on the surface of the pad. The level of the pressure on the surface might be raised to a definite level, although putting on over the most effective amount of pressure not just cuts down the quality level of the process, but in addition can degrade efficiency, can lead to wear on the product, and there is additionally a noticeable heating of the pieces being worked on, brought about by friction. With thinner objects, it's greater temperature (and a corresponding flexibility of the metal) which can cause components to twist, flex, or bend. In general, it needs an educated polisher to take into account each one of these things to both prevent harm to the part and to do the project competently. To help you appreciably improve the standard of the final surface area, the polishing procedure should really be accomplished with a lot less aggression and not a large amount of force to be able to in time produce a surface area that is free of scores or marks coming from the buffing process, thus ending up with a sleek mirror finish.
